2. A Rookie Will Become the Star of the Week
History shows that Ryder Cups often produce unlikely heroes. In 2021, rookie Scottie Scheffler upset world No. 1 Jon Rahm. In 2012, rookie Nicolas Colsaerts became Europe’s hero in Medinah.
With so much young talent on both sides, don’t be surprised if a rookie steals the spotlight at Bethpage. Someone like Ludvig Åberg for Team Europe or Sahith Theegala for Team USA could step up, silencing doubters and energizing their side.

4. Europe Will Mount a Stunning Comeback on Sunday
Team USA may enter as favorites, especially on home soil, but Europe has proven time and again that they thrive under pressure. Just remember the “Miracle at Medinah” in 2012, where Europe came from 10-6 down to pull off one of the greatest comebacks in golf history.
